Early Life and Education

Stephen Belichick grew up in a football family, where discussions about game strategies and player performances were commonplace. His father, Bill Belichick, has been a pivotal figure in the NFL, known for his innovative coaching techniques and success with the Patriots. Stephen attended the College of the Holy Cross, where he played as a linebacker. His time on the field provided him with firsthand experience of the challenges and dynamics of the game, shaping his future coaching endeavors.

Coaching Career

After completing his education, Stephen began his coaching career as a coaching assistant with the New England Patriots in 2012. Over the years, he has worked his way up the ranks, gaining valuable experience and insights into the game. He was named the safeties coach in 2019, a role that allowed him to work closely with the defensive unit and develop strategies that contributed to the team's overall success.
